Overview
As the Category Manager, you will provide thought leadership and drive strategic sourcing activities for indirect categories supporting Operations, including MRO and Packaging. You will work closely with global business and functional leaders across Fortune Brands to develop and implement sourcing strategies that effectively reduce category spend and total cost of ownership, leveraging strong negotiation skills, supplier relationship management, and best practices. You will create world-class tools and processes to lead transformation in collaboration with stakeholders, building strong working relationships across organizational functions.
